    Poloroid PLV68155S67 - PLV68155E15-01-01 15.6"

    Afternoon Guys,

    This isn't the usual Me asking for help, Just want to Pay back some of the advice i have been given over the years and post a fix for the Above TV...

    Background to this was that a friend of a friend brought me this 15.6" TV that he used for his CCTV system in his shop....

    Someone had already had a go at fixing it but told him it wasnt fixable....

    To me that is a challenge....

    Symptoms were that the TV would power on to a steady red light... No blinks, no flashes just dead...

    My first thought was being a poloroid that a Diode had died on the Vestel board like usual.... But i had not seen one of these all in one 12V boards before....

    So after a few hours of scratching my head and shaking my head at the dodgy soldering done by the previous trier.... I got out my multi meter and started testing Voltage regulators thanks to the help from the V Reg Testing thread i could figure out that one of the following could have been the issue.

    U904
    1117SADJ

    Pin1 - 0.67V
    Pin2 - 0.53V
    Pin3 - 4.27V
    ------------------------------

    U903
    1117-S33

    Pin1 - 0.00V
    Pin2 - 3.29V
    Pin3 - 4.89V
    ------------------------------

    U908
    1117-S33

    Pin1 - 0.00V
    Pin2 - 3.02V
    Pin3 - 4.89V
    ------------------------------


    I surmised that the possibility was that either U904 was at fault or something around it was faulty....

    After Testing the voltages and tracing where the components went to... i replaced the U904 Regulator and plugged in for a first test...

    Boooo Ya.... The TV powered straight up...

    Hope this helps someone, although i know that the 15.6 inch TV's are quite rare these days... a V Reg could be at fault on other TV's Like the Supermarket cheaper brands....
